A close watch: IST seed grant funds study to assess and predict substance co-use

Screen-Shot-2019-03-18-at-2.18.02-PM

Sahiti Kunchay, a doctoral student in the College of Information Sciences and Technology, displays a survey designed to assess a young adult's alcohol and marijuana co-use using an Apple Watch. Kunchay helped to design the survey application as part of an interdisciplinary study being conducted by researchers in the College of IST and the College of Health and Human Development at Penn State.
